WHITE PLUMES ASTERN

The Short, Daring Life of Canada’s MTB Flotilla

Description

Nimbus, Halifax, 1989.  ISBN 0-921054-27-0.  Hard cover, 170 pages including Glossary, Index and Abbreviations.  Very good; blue boards with silver lettering on spine; a few small spots on boards; a bit of corner and spine end wear; binding sound.  Unpriced dust jacket has a bit of edge and cover wear, some scratches on rear panel.  Book interior clean and unmarked, a bit of age spotting on outer page block; black & white photos and illustrations.  ‘In this compelling book C. Anthony Law resurrects the history of the 29th Motor Torpedo Boat Flotilla, from its formation in Hythe, England, in February 1944 to its tragic demise in the harbour of Ostend, Belgium, one year later.  This is the complete story of the Flotilla, a story peppered with more than 70 illustrations.’ (from front flap)
